Default Update - complete fail!!!

So I have had a rough few days. My trip to Chicago has been cancelled after sitting at BWI for 8 hours yesterday, 2 planes - both broke down on the tarmac. I should have seen this as a sign of things to come.

I was trying to be slightly stealthy and take the car to F:T on the down low for tuning this weekend. I picked up the car from Hill's on Wednesday night and headed to VA to drop it off. The car drove just fine (still hella loud) and cruises on the highway at 80mph in 6th gear at 2900ish rpm with the new 3.3 rear diff.

I spoke with Dave last night after fleeing from the second failed plane with visions of the Final Destination movies in my head. The ViPEC was wired up, boost control installed and things were looking good. The start-up issue was being worked out and the car was idling smoothly.

Got a call from Dave this morning. After installing the wastegate springs and working on the A/F ratio at idle the car showed zero oil pressure and was exhibiting "rod knock" at idle. Dave says the motor may have spun a bearing, but this is not certain at this time.

Frank is having the car towed back to his shop so the motor can be pulled and torn down to find the cause of the failure. I would like to point out that I am lucky to be working with some of the best shops in the business and am very fortunate to not have any accusations or finger pointing between anyone involved as to what caused this problem. Frank immediately took ownership of the issue, without knowing the cause of the failure, and is dealing with the costs involved with making things right for me. A huge step up for a one man shop.

I will ask only that people do not attempt to wildly speculate on the cause and certainly do not question the competence of either my builder or tuner. They aren't the largest or most well known shops, but they are some of the best IMO.

I will post full results of the teardown and be sure to let everyone know what went wrong and hopefully why. Maybe this motor is just cursed .
